Foros del Web » Administración de Sistemas » Apache »

proteger directorio

Estas en el tema de proteger directorio en el foro de Apache en Foros del Web. Hola a todos. Tengo un archivo .htaccess con este contenido: Código: AuthType Basic AuthUserFile /xxxxxx/datos2.txt AuthGroupFile /dev/null AuthName "Administrador" IndexIgnore * <Files "acc_adm.html"> Require user ...
  #1 (permalink)  
Antiguo 18/07/2012, 05:30
 
Fecha de Ingreso: diciembre-2003
Mensajes: 474
Antigüedad: 20 años, 11 meses
Puntos: 5
proteger directorio

Hola a todos.
Tengo un archivo .htaccess con este contenido:

Código:
AuthType Basic
AuthUserFile /xxxxxx/datos2.txt
AuthGroupFile /dev/null
AuthName "Administrador"
IndexIgnore *
<Files "acc_adm.html">
 Require user adm
</Files>
Mi sistema protege el archivo acc_adm.html (que es un formulario que utiliza el administrador para añadir nuevos usuarios y claves). Esos nuevos datos se incluyen en el archivo datos2.txt.

Ahora lo que quiero es proteger una carpeta "imágenes" que está dentro del directorio donde está el .htaccess. Ya sé que "imágenes" está protegida pero quiero que los datos de acceso a esa carpeta se saquen de otro archivo datos.txt ¿Tengo que crear otro archivo .htaccess o basta con incluir unas líneas en el que ya existe?

Creo que lo he complicado pero llevo tiempo con esto y esta es la mejor solución que he encontrado.

Y lo último: ¿Para qué sirve el <limit GET>? He visto que a veces se incluye en el .htaccess y otras no...

Gracias por todo.
  #2 (permalink)  
Antiguo 19/07/2012, 17:18
Avatar de emprear
Colaborador
 
Fecha de Ingreso: junio-2007
Ubicación: me mudé
Mensajes: 8.388
Antigüedad: 17 años, 4 meses
Puntos: 1567
Respuesta: proteger directorio

El manual de apache habla de que el contexto para AuthUserFile es .htaccess ó directory, a la segunda no tenés acceso salvo como administrador, en la segunda si pones 2 AuthUserFile no creo que te funcione, pero para que dos archivos de passwords?

Deja esto en el actual

<Files "acc_adm.html">
AuthType Basic
AuthUserFile /www/datos2.txt
AuthGroupFile /dev/null
AuthName "Administrador"
Require user adm
</Files>

para que afecte unicamente al archivo indicado, y crea otro en la carpeta imágenes apuntando al mismo archivo de claves

HTTP admite distíntos tipos de métodos (put, get, post) con esto estás limitando solo a get
__________________
La voz de las antenas va, sustituyendo a Dios.
Cuando finalice la mutación, nueva edad media habrá
S.R.

Etiquetas: directorio, htaccess, proteger
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 08:57.